レスポンシブWebデザインでは幅にパーセントを使った指定をします。 そのパーセント値やパーセント値からpx値に置き換えた値は小数点以下の値が出てくることがよくあります。 そんなときブラウザはどのようにまるめる計算しているのかを検証したエントリーがあったのでご紹介。 まず、最初にブラウザのアクションは2つあります。 ひとつはパーセンテージの丸め方。 IE7-11…小数点第二位に切り捨てる上記以外のモダンブラウザ…より多くの小数点以下の桁数を丸めるもう一つはパーセンテージから割り出されたピクセル値の出し方。 IE8を例にみてみます。 例コンテナの幅は 1325pxコンテナ内のボックスに幅 50.5290112% を指定このボックスの幅は計算上は 669.5093984px ( (1325 / 100) x 50.5290112)IE8では669pxになるIE8でどう計算されているかというと、